Lot Essay

Goedaert, a naturalist as well as a painter, appears to have lived all his life in Middelburg. Although his paintings are little known, his Metamorphosis naturalis, a three-volume work on insects published in Middelburg in 1662-9, contained some 150 engravings of insects previously drawn by him in watercolour. Only two other landscapes in oil by the artist appear to be known: one is in the Liechtenstein Gallery, Vaduz, the other is at the Victoria and Albert Museum, London (see C.M. Kauffmann, Victoria and Albert Museum. Catalogue of Foreign Paintings. I. Before 1800, London, 1973, pp. 135-6, no. 154, illustrated). Apart from these, there appear to be only a few other known works by the artist: two flower still lifes in Dutch private collections, and landscape drawings in the Albertina, Vienna, the Rijksprentenkabinet, Amsterdam and in a private collection, Brussels (see ibid., p. 135).
